## Runbook: Hermetic migration for the Marrowgate build

This week we moved Marrowgate's packaging step into the hermetic Ovenbird toolchain. All network fetches are now pinned in the lockfile; ad-hoc curl calls will fail by design. Remaining non-hermetic targets are tracked for next sprint. Validate any migrated target against the token below.

trace token, kahog-tajeg: htk6_97d963

## Who to Contact: Password Reset Revamp

The Lockmere reset flow is being rebuilt under project Keyturn. For design questions, ask the Keyturn working group; for rollout timing, ask the Tidewell release crew. Please do not modify legacy reset templates without sign-off. For all other Keyturn questions, reach the project inbox directly.

escalation mailbox, hadug-bajog: sormir@norvalabs.internal

## Session Handling for Health Checks

The Corvel gateway sits behind the Lanternside load balancer, which probes /healthz every ten seconds. Health-check requests are stateless by design: they bypass the session store entirely so that probe traffic never inflates session counts or evicts real user sessions. New team members should note that the deep-check endpoint, /healthz/deep, does verify session-store connectivity and therefore requires authentication. When probing it manually, supply the token below.

bearer token for tajep-kajef: eyJhbGciOiJIUzI1NiIsInR5cCI6IkpXVCJ9.eyJzdWIiOiIoOsZ23In0.CsygO0hs

- [ ] ChipLine reader: confirm firmware flashed on all mat units before the Dunmoor Half. Scan a test chip at each mat; verify split times post within two seconds. If a mat shows stale reads, power-cycle once, then swap hardware. Support should match each unit's reported version against the token below.

trace token, fafog-kageg: htk4_98e6

Partitioning — Ledgerpine Warehouse

Tables in Ledgerpine are partitioned by calendar month. Writers target the current partition only; older partitions are read-only after day three. Retention jobs drop partitions past 18 months. Access to the partition manager is scoped per environment. The reviewer tooling queries the internal catalog service, authenticating with the key that follows.

service key, bajog-yahop: kto7_mMHVCpJ